Cassandra Clare, the author best known for the Mortal Instrument series, is back with the second installment of her other New York Times best-selling series, The Infernal Devices Trilogy. As you count down the seconds until Dec. 6, when Clockwork Princehits shelves, we have a haunting, cinematic trailer that will transport you to Victorian London, where Shadowhunters roam the misty streets, the Magister is up to his dark deeds, and the Tessa-Jem-Will love triangle continues.

If the voice in the trailer sounds familiar to you, that’s because it belongs to Gossip Girl star Ed Westwick, who also narrates the audio versions of the books. The third and final Infernal Devices book is slated for Sept. 2013. See the Clockwork Prince trailer below!

There’s a rare opportunity to buy autographs by stars of stage and screen, sports stars, musicians, actors and politicians in the KISS (Kiddies Support Scheme) auction.

KISS supports many education projects for children, as well as two Catholic parishes and other initiatives in Uganda.

There are signed cards, shirts and memorabilia from sports champions: Steven Gerrard, Lewis Hamilton, Michael Owen, lan Shearer, Amir Kahn, Sir Bobby Charlton, Paula Radcliffe MBE, Jermain Defoe, Jamie Redknapp, Steve Backley OBE, Jonathan Woodgate, Steve Davis OBE, Ricky Hatton, and  Harlequins.

Among musicians’ autographs are: Annie Lennox, Ellie Goulding, Alesha Dixon, Martin Kemp, Olly Murs, Charlene Spiteri (Texas), Ronan Keating, Rumer and Peter Gabriel.

TV and film stars include: Ed Westwick, an Eastenders Collection, John Cleese, Joanna Lumley, Dermot O’Leary, Len Goodman, Wendy Richard, Phil and Fern, Sir Bruce Forsyth,  Paul Kaye, Rory Bremner, Alistair McGowan, Alan Carr, Tom Baker,  Nigella Lawson, Strictly Come Dancing’s Vincent and Flavia, Miranda Hart,  Ed Westwick, Jim Broadbent, Emily Watson, Guy Ritchie, Ewan McGregor, Robbie Coltrane, Sir Ian McKellen as Gandalf, Nanny McPhee Goodies, Dame Helen Mirren, Dame Judi Dench, Jude Law, Patrick Stewart.

There is even a signed photo of Tony Blair.
